What is a Beard Hair Transplant?

A beard hair transplant is a surgical procedure where hair follicles are extracted from areas with dense hair growth, such as the scalp, and implanted in the beard region. This process is typically done using two methods: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) and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T). Both methods aim to restore facial hair growth by transplanting hair follicles in a way that mimics natural beard growth patterns. The treatment is ideal for individuals who want to address uneven growth, scarring, or lack of facial hair altogether.

How Does the Beard Hair Transplant Procedure Work?

The beard hair transplant procedure typically starts with a consultation to discuss the desired outcome and assess the patient’s hair type and facial structure. The doctor then selects the appropriate technique—FUE or FUT—and extracts hair follicles from the donor area. These follicles are carefully implanted in the beard area, ensuring a natural growth pattern.


The procedure is done under local anesthesia, making it painless. The healing time is relatively quick, with patients experiencing minimal discomfort after the treatment.


Post-Transplant Care for Best Results

Following the transplant, proper aftercare is crucial to ensure the best possible results. Patients are usually advised to avoid shaving the transplanted area for a few weeks to allow the follicles to settle. Additionally, keeping the area clean and following the doctor’s advice on hair care is essential for a smooth recovery and optimal hair growth.


FAQs:

How soon can I see results after a beard transplant?

It typically takes 3 to 4 months before the transplanted hairs begin to show noticeable growth. Full results may take up to 12 months as the hair follicles settle and begin growing in the new location.


Does the transplanted beard hair look natural?

Yes, the transplanted hair will grow naturally and blend with your existing beard, making it look seamless and natural.


Will I experience any side effects after the transplant?

There are minimal side effects such as mild swelling, redness, or scabbing, which typically subside within a few days to weeks.


Can I shave my beard after the transplant?

Shaving should be avoided for the first few weeks following the transplant to allow the hair follicles to properly settle and heal.


Is a beard hair transplant permanent?

Yes, the results of a beard transplant are permanent. The transplanted hair follicles continue to grow throughout life, just like the hair in the donor area.
